> Can biochemical processes be used to construct
> and manipulate metallic substances?
> 
> (i.e., planting a seed, and growing a car?)

Numerous organisms, from bacteria to plants to animals, are capable of
creating and using proteins that bind metal ions - things like chlorophyll
and hemoglobin. There are even pathways by which many of these same
organisms create magnetic iron crystals inside their tissues. There are
magnetotactic bacteria, honeybees have iron crystals in special organs to
aid in orientation, as do at least some birds, and - if I recall correctly
- even human beings have certain tissues in which magnetic iron crystals
are formed. Whether this could ever be exploited for anything larger and
more complex is highly questionable, and I'd say your example is pushing
the limits a bit too far. Ask yourself this...could we "program" a set of
genes to make *bones* in a shape of our own design?? If you think *that*
is a long way from being practical, now just make the task an order of
magnitude more difficult. Fairly unlikely, I'd think.
